/** * App-facing ID generation port. * * Use this when deterministic IDs matter in use-case tests or when production * infrastructure owns ID generation. */ export interface IdGeneratorPort { /** * Return the next ID. */ nextId(): string; } /** * Mutable sequential ID generator used by tests and simple examples. */ export interface SequenceIdGeneratorPort extends IdGeneratorPort { /** * Reset the next sequence value. */ reset(next?: number): void; } /** * Create an ID generator backed by `globalThis.crypto.randomUUID()`. * * The factory itself does not read from `crypto`; the returned generator's * `nextId()` method throws if the current runtime does not expose * `globalThis.crypto.randomUUID()`. * * @returns An ID generator that returns UUID strings from `nextId()`. */ export function createUuidIdGenerator(): IdGeneratorPort { return { nextId: () => { if (typeof globalThis.crypto?.randomUUID !== "function") { throw new Error( "createUuidIdGenerator requires globalThis.crypto.randomUUID(). Provide a custom IdGeneratorPort in this runtime.", ); } return globalThis.crypto.randomUUID(); }, }; } /** * Create a deterministic sequence ID generator for tests and examples. * * @example * ```ts * const ids = createSequenceIdGenerator({ prefix: "post", start: 10 }); * ids.nextId(); // "post_10" * ids.nextId(); // "post_11" * ``` * * @param options - Optional ID prefix and starting sequence number. * @returns A mutable sequence ID generator. */ export function createSequenceIdGenerator( options: { prefix?: string; start?: number } = {}, ): SequenceIdGeneratorPort { const prefix = options.prefix ?? "id"; const start = options.start ?? 1; let next = start; return { nextId: () => `${prefix}_${next++}`, reset: (value = start) => { next = value; }, }; }
